Frequently asked questions
How many towers does West Virginia Radio Corporation of Charleston own?
West Virginia Radio Corporation of Charleston holds 3 FCC antenna structure registrations, with the largest concentration in West Virginia (3). Only FCC-registrable structures are counted — shorter sites below the registration threshold don't appear.
What is the tallest structure West Virginia Radio Corporation of Charleston owns?
Its tallest registered structure is 93 m (304 ft) near Guthrie, WV (registration 1036503).
